Entry List: 2016 Petit Le Mans presented by Harrah’s Cherokee Casino Resort

Recently, IMSA released the official entry list for Saturday’s 19th Annual Petit Le Mans presented by Harrah’s Cherokee Casino Resort (Note: This resort/presenting sponsor is located in Cherokee, N.C., approximately 119 miles away from the track).  Officially, 41 cars are listed.  However, 37 will show up.

With Saturday’s race being ten hours in length, the vast majority of the teams have brought in third drivers to fill out their driving lineups.  Also, there are a couple of teams that have not run all the races that are back as well.  The most notable example of this is Tequila Patron ESM, who has entered their No. 2 Ligier JS P2-HPD with the lineup of team owner Scott Sharp, Johannes van Overbeek and Pipo Derani.  Other third drivers in the Prototype ranks include Andy Meyrick, Filipe Albuquerque, Max Angelelli, Verizon IndyCar Series champion Simon Pagenaud, and more.

Prototype Challenge is down to seven entries on the list, but it is really six since CORE autosport has withdrawn their No. 54 from the series in order to prepare for their full-time schedule in GT Daytona with a Porsche 911 GT3 R in 2017.  Expect the class to be relatively lean in 2017 as the class is gradually phased out.  Multiple teams have already announced plans outside of PC for next season, while others are still in the planning stages.

GT Le Mans is back up to ten entries with Scuderia Corsa bringing their No. 68 Ferrari 488 GTE out to play.  Of note, yes, it has been on the entry list for every race this season as it is considered a full-season entry, but it is a part-time team.

Finally, GT Daytona looks to have a season-low 12 entries take the track.  15 are listed, but that includes Alex Job Racing’s No. 22, which has already withdrawn for the season.  It also includes Change Racing’s No. 11, which hasn’t raced since the Spring and Black Swan Racing’s No. 540, which was parked after Tim Pappas‘ father died.  The team is getting back to the track, but it will be in next weekend’s Pirelli World Challenge finale at Mazda Raceway Laguna Seca.
